centos链接oracle
本文将介绍如何在CentOS上链接Oracle数据库。Oracle是一款十分流行的关系型数据库管理系统,广泛应用于企业级应用和数据处理领域。但是,在CentOS系统中,需要一定的配置和安装才能与Oracle库建立连接。下面是一些具体的步骤和注意事项。
安装Oracle客户端
首先,我们需要在CentOS中安装Oracle客户端。这个过程可以通过下载Oracle客户端的RPM文件来完成。下面是具体的步骤。
sudo yum install -y oracle-instantclient19.3-basic-19.3.0.0.0-1.x86_64.rpm
sudo yum install -y oracle-instantclient19.3-devel-19.3.0.0.0-1.x86_64.rpm
echo /usr/lib/oracle/19.3/client64/lib >>/etc/ld.so.conf.d/oracle-instantclient.conf
sudo ldconfig
echo 'export ORACLE_HOME=/usr/lib/oracle/19.3/client64' >>~/.bashrc
echo 'export PATH=$PATH:$ORACLE_HOME/bin' >>~/.bashrc
source ~/.bashrc
import cx_Oracle
dsn = cx_Oracle.makedsn('hostname', 'port', service_name='sid')
connection = cx_Oracle.connect('username/password@' + dsn)
cursor = connection.cursor()
cursor.execute('SELECT * FROMtable_name')
print(cursor.fetchone())
cursor.close()
connection.close()